Understanding Your Power Adapter and Connector Types
Power adapters come with various connector types, each designed for specific devices. Common connector types include USB-A, USB-C, Lightning, and Micro USB. Knowing which type your device requires is the first step in finding a compatible connector.
Steps to Find Compatible Mobile Connectors
- Check Your Device’s Port: Examine the port on your device to identify its type. It may be labeled or recognizable by shape and size.
- Review Your Power Adapter: Look at the connector on your current charger. Note its type and specifications, such as voltage and current output.
- Match Connector Types: Select a connector that matches your device’s port. For example, if your device has a USB-C port, choose a USB-C connector.
- Verify Compatibility: Ensure the connector is compatible with your power adapter’s output specifications to prevent damage.
- Consider Quality and Certification: Opt for connectors from reputable brands that meet safety standards and certifications.
Additional Tips for Safe Charging
Using the correct connector and ensuring compatibility can extend the lifespan of your device and prevent potential hazards. Avoid cheap or uncertified connectors, as they may cause overheating or damage.
